About the Course
Blessed Birthings is a spiritually rooted childbirth education and fiqh-based guide designed for Muslim women who want to approach pregnancy, labor, and the early postpartum period with knowledge, clarity, and deep trust in their Lord. Whether you are expecting your first child, preparing for a future pregnancy, or supporting others as a doula or birth worker, this course integrates Islamic spirituality, Hanafi fiqh, and evidence-based childbirth education into one grounded, faith-filled learning experience. This course includes the complete 4-hour recording of the Blessed Birthings workshop, giving you full access to the exact teaching delivered live—rich with Qur’anic reminders, birth physiology, emotional preparation, and practical guidance. You’ll also receive a course syllabus and downloadable student handouts to support your learning. You will explore how Allah created the body to birth naturally and powerfully, and learn how to reconnect with your God-given ability to birth with confidence. The course guides you through natural coping methods, dhikr-based breathing, emotional readiness, labor positions, and how to create a spiritually uplifting birth environment—whether at home, a birth center, or in a hospital. In the fiqh section, you’ll learn the essential rulings every woman needs for pregnancy and labor: purification, prayer modifications, tayammum, istihaadha, and the correct understanding of nifaas and postpartum worship. The course also covers newborn sunnahs, early postpartum rites, and the fiqh of intimacy after birth. Through Qur’anic reflection—especially the powerful story of Lady Maryam (AS) and the sincerity of her mother Hannah—and the reminder that the womb (ar-rahim) is derived from Allah’s Name Ar-Rahmān, you’ll be guided to prepare with tawakkul, emotional steadiness, and spiritual presence. You will walk into birth connected to your body, your baby, and your Creator—anchored in trust, strengthened by knowledge, and ready for a blessed beginning into motherhood.

About the Instructor
Ustadha Shamira is a certified birth doula, certified lactation counselor, childbirth educator, and midwifery student, as well as a qualified ʿālimah (Islamic scholar). A mother of five children born naturally — including three planned home births where she birthed and caught her own baby — she brings lived experience, deep compassion, and scholarly grounding to her work. Since 2013, Ustadha Shamira has supported women with menstrual, lochia, and abnormal discharge inquiries, offering clear guidance rooted in Hanafi fiqh. She has been teaching natural childbirth with Islamic spirituality since 2009, helping women approach pregnancy and birth as acts of worship filled with trust, presence, and connection to Allah ﷻ. She continues to study midwifery and diverse birth modalities, driven by her commitment to helping women reach their highest potential in their pregnancy, birth, and postpartum journeys — with clarity, dignity, and confidence in their God-given strength.
